diff --git a/paddle/fluid/eager/to_static/run_program_op_func.h b/paddle/fluid/eager/to_static/run_program_op_func.h index 10677589b2bebe731cc072c838bdcb3d1ce40df9..db9b84f4f88b984a0fbd8eb46a0971de14a900f2 100644 --- a/paddle/fluid/eager/to_static/run_program_op_func.h +++ b/paddle/fluid/eager/to_static/run_program_op_func.h @@ -75,7 +75,7 @@ static void clear_unused_out_var_in_backward( delete garbages; } -static std::vector filte_unused_input_var_in_backward( +static std::vector filter_unused_input_var_in_backward( const std::vector& x, const paddle::framework::BlockDesc* backward_block) { auto filter_x = std::vector(x); @@ -130,7 +130,7 @@ inline void run_program_ad_func( paddle::framework::BlockDesc*, attrs.at("backward_global_block")); // Clear unused x vars auto filter_x = - filte_unused_input_var_in_backward(x, backward_global_block); + filter_unused_input_var_in_backward(x, backward_global_block); grad_node->SetFwdX(filter_x); // Clear unused out vars clear_unused_out_var_in_backward(out, backward_global_block, step_scope[0]);